A major fire broke out at the Hilltop Campers site in Llandudno Junction, North Wales, on Thursday night, prompting an emergency response from 60 firefighters across six fire crews.

The fire, thought to have started because of an electrical problem, was only in the building, but it damaged cars, machines, and other equipment.


The fire started at 10:02pm. Emergency services from Llandudno, Colwyn Bay, Conwy, Abergele, and Wrexham came to fight the fire.

Teams used hosereel jets, main jets, and breathing apparatus to fight the flames. Fortunately, no injuries were reported, and surrounding buildings weren't affected.


According to Yahoo News, a spokesperson for Hilltop Campers confirmed that an American RV and a converted ambulance were among the damaged vehicles. Despite the losses, the spokesperson noted that “it could have been worse.”

What This Means for the Campervan Industry

This incident highlights the operational risks that businesses in the campervan and motorhome sector face, particularly regarding fire safety in workshop environments.


While Hilltop Campers has been fortunate to avoid more significant damage, the industry must remain vigilant about electrical safety, fire prevention, and risk management in manufacturing and conversion processes.

For UK campervan dealers and workshop operators, this is a reminder to review fire safety protocols and ensure premises are fully compliant with industry best practices.

With demand for bespoke campervan conversions on the rise, incidents like this can have long-term impacts on supply chains and delivery schedules.
